Industrial operations increasingly depend on materials that combine durability with adaptability, and industrial films fulfill this requirement across multiple sectors. These films provide protective, insulating, and stabilizing functions that support efficient workflows in manufacturing plants, warehouses, and construction sites. Their lightweight nature and versatility make them ideal for modern industrial applications.

The Industrial film Market continues to expand as industries prioritize operational efficiency and product safety. Industrial films are widely used to protect machinery components, finished goods, and raw materials from dust, moisture, and physical damage. This protection reduces losses, enhances quality control, and improves overall supply chain reliability.

Technological advancements have significantly improved the performance characteristics of industrial films. Multi-layer film structures now offer enhanced tensile strength, tear resistance, and thermal stability. These features allow films to perform under challenging industrial conditions while maintaining flexibility. Such advancements are particularly valuable in sectors such as automotive manufacturing, electronics, and heavy equipment logistics.

Environmental responsibility is another critical influence shaping the market. Industrial users are seeking solutions that reduce environmental impact without compromising durability. As a result, recyclable films and materials compatible with circular economy models are becoming more prevalent. This shift encourages manufacturers to redesign products and optimize production processes for sustainability.

Industrial films also support automation and smart logistics systems. Films compatible with automated wrapping equipment help improve packaging speed and consistency, reducing labor dependency. Additionally, films designed for traceability and labeling support digital inventory management and quality assurance systems, enhancing operational transparency.
